Documents change. If you add more pages, delete text, or mark new terms, your index page numbers will become inaccurate. Word does not update the index automatically in real-time, but fixing it takes only two clicks. How to Update the Index:

Note: Marking index entries activates hidden formatting tags called XE (Index Entry) fields. Your document may suddenly show formatting symbols like paragraph marks ( ¶ ) and text inside curly brackets XE "term" . These are hidden codes and will not appear when the document is printed.
